List of important dates and events in the United States for 2026

US Federal Holidays (Nationwide)

These are official U.S. federal holidays (most offices, banks and government services closed). 

January

  • Jan 1 (Thu): New Year’s Day – Federal holiday.
  • Jan 19 (Mon): Martin Luther King Jr. Day – 3rd Monday of January.

February

  • Feb 16 (Mon): Presidents’ Day – 3rd Monday of February.

May

  • May 25 (Mon): Memorial Day – Last Monday of May.

June / July

  • Jun 19 (Fri): Juneteenth National Independence Day – Celebrates emancipation.
  • Jul 3 (Fri): Independence Day — Observed (since Jul 4 falls on a Saturday) – Federal holiday observed on July 3.

September

  • Sep 7 (Mon): Labor Day – First Monday of September.

October

  • Oct 12 (Mon): Columbus Day / Indigenous Peoples’ Day – 2nd Monday of October.

November

  • Nov 11 (Wed): Veterans Day – Honors U.S. military veterans.
  • Nov 26 (Thu): Thanksgiving Day – 4th Thursday of November.

December

  • Dec 25 (Fri): Christmas Day – Federal holiday.

🎖 250th Anniversary — “Semiquincentennial” (America250)

  • July 4 (Sat): 250th anniversary of U.S. independence
    The United States celebrates its Semiquincentennial — the 250th anniversary of the Declaration of Independence — with nationwide events and commemorations.
